Subject: [PATCH net-next] net: spread "enum sock_flags"
Date: Thu, 3 Oct 2019 23:56:37 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20191003205637.GA24270@avx2> (raw)
Some ints are "enum sock_flags" in fact.
Signed-off-by: Alexey Dobriyan <adobriyan@gmail.com>
---
include/net/sock.h | 2 +-
net/core/sock.c | 5 +++--
2 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
--- a/include/net/sock.h
+++ b/include/net/sock.h
@@ -2512,7 +2512,7 @@ static inline bool sk_listener(const struct sock *sk)
return (1 << sk->sk_state) & (TCPF_LISTEN | TCPF_NEW_SYN_RECV);
}
-void sock_enable_timestamp(struct sock *sk, int flag);
+void sock_enable_timestamp(struct sock *sk, enum sock_flags flag);
int sock_recv_errqueue(struct sock *sk, struct msghdr *msg, int len, int level,
int type);
--- a/net/core/sock.c
+++ b/net/core/sock.c
@@ -687,7 +687,8 @@ static int sock_getbindtodevice(struct sock *sk, char __user *optval,
return ret;
}
-static inline void sock_valbool_flag(struct sock *sk, int bit, int valbool)
+static inline void sock_valbool_flag(struct sock *sk, enum sock_flags bit,
+ int valbool)
{
if (valbool)
sock_set_flag(sk, bit);
@@ -3033,7 +3034,7 @@ int sock_gettstamp(struct socket *sock, void __user *userstamp,
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(sock_gettstamp);
-void sock_enable_timestamp(struct sock *sk, int flag)
+void sock_enable_timestamp(struct sock *sk, enum sock_flags flag)
{
if (!sock_flag(sk, flag)) {
unsigned long previous_flags = sk->sk_flags;
